Bacterial defiance as a form of prodrug failure
2019-02-21
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Classifying the mechanisms of antibiotic failure has led to the development of new treatment strategies for killing bacteria. Among the currently described mechanisms, which include resistance, persistence and tolerance, we propose bacterial defiance as a form of antibiotic failure specific to prodrugs.
